Madison Square Garden Entertainment Corp. (MSG Entertainment) is a leader in live entertainment, delivering unforgettable experiences while forging deep connections with diverse and passionate audiences. The Company’s portfolio includes a collection of world-renowned venues – New York’s Madison Square Garden, Infosys Theater at Madison Square Garden, Radio City Music Hall, and Beacon Theatre; and The Chicago Theatre – that showcase a broad array of sporting events, concerts, family shows, and special events for millions of guests annually. In addition, the Company features the original production, the Christmas Spectacular Starring the Radio City Rockettes, which has been a holiday tradition for more than 90 years. Who are we hiring?
Under the supervision of the Senior Director Procurement F&B, the Buyer is responsible for daily purchasing, sourcing, and inventory management across all food and beverage operations, including Madison Square Garden Arena, Radio City Music Hall, The Beacon Theater, The Chicago Theater, and the Knicks and Rangers Training Center.
What will you do?
- Execute tactical buying for food, beverage, and paper/packaging products across all venues
- Analyze requisitions from multiple locations and develop efficient, cost-effective purchasing strategies
- Place orders through Eatec, MSG’s inventory and procurement system
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date product information within the Eatec database
- Troubleshoot delivery issues, including shortage and out of stocks, in a timely manner
- Build and manage strong vendor relationships to ensure consistent product availability and service quality
- Support the vendor bidding process by assisting with bid analysis, RFPs, and vendor selection
- Establish and manage par levels for stocked inventory items to ensure optimal inventory levels
- Evaluate product forecasting needs based on event schedules and usage trends
- Source new vendor and products as needed to support operational goals and enhance offerings
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ams—including Warehouse, Culinary, Operations and Accounts Payable—to effectively execute procurement initiatives and alignment across departments
- Manage invoice and credit reconciliation to maintain accurate financial records and resolve discrepancies
